Trigger from Arduino into OpenBCI
Hello,
I created a test with a pushbutton in Arduino (NG version) and would like to incorporate the pushbutton signal (once the button is pressed) into the OpenBCI (v3-32bit) board.
Ideally, I would like to do that in a way that in the output text file from OpenBCI processing GUI, one of columns is related to the pushbutton so I can check when it was pressed.
I saw there's this tutorial for external trigerring:
http://docs.openbci.com/Tutorials/06-External_Trigger_Cyton_Example
But, since the output is from Arduino, maybe there's an easier way?
Any suggestions?
